The cheapest way to get from Santa Cruz to Laoag is to bus which costs ₱500 - ₱1,000 and takes 2h 46m.
The fastest way to get from Santa Cruz to Laoag is to drive which takes 2h 45m and costs ₱1,100 - ₱1,700.
No, there is no direct bus from Santa Cruz to Laoag. However, there are services departing from Candon and arriving at Laoag via . The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 46m.
The distance between Santa Cruz and Laoag is 152 km. The road distance is 147.3 km.
The best way to get from Santa Cruz to Laoag without a car is to bus which takes 2h 46m and costs ₱500 - ₱1,000.
It takes approximately 2h 46m to get from Santa Cruz to Laoag, including transfers.
Santa Cruz to Laoag bus services, operated by Partas, depart from Candon station.
Santa Cruz to Laoag bus services, operated by Partas, arrive at Laoag station.
Yes, the driving distance between Santa Cruz to Laoag is 147 km. It takes approximately 2h 45m to drive from Santa Cruz to Laoag.
There are 80+ hotels available in Laoag.
What companies run services between Santa Cruz, Ilocos, Philippines and Laoag, Philippines?
Partas operates a bus from Candon to Laoag every 4 hours. Tickets cost ₱290–700 and the journey takes 2h 31m.
